This article explores the advancements in geared DC motors and their applications across multiple sectors.Section 1: Understanding Geared DC MotorsGeared DC motors, a subtype of direct current (DC) motors, are widely recognized for their versatility, adaptability, and exceptional power efficiency. Unlike traditional motors, geared DC motors integrate a gear mechanism within the motor housing, allowing for controlled speed, torque transmission, and direction control. Equipped with advanced gear systems, these motors offer precise movement, reduced vibrations, and improved accuracy.Section 2: Advantages of Geared DC Motors2.1 Enhanced PerformanceGeared DC motors exhibit remarkable performance levels due to the gear system's ability to distribute power effectively. The addition of gear mechanisms improves torque capabilities, enabling these motors to generate higher force while maintaining precise movement control. As a result, geared DC motors are ideal for applications that require both strength and precision, such as robotics, automation, and industrial machinery.2.2 Energy EfficiencyGeared DC motors are specifically engineered to maximize power efficiency. By incorporating gears, the motor can operate at higher speeds while minimizing power consumption, resulting in reduced energy costs. This efficiency makes them the optimal choice for battery-operated devices, electric vehicles, and renewable energy systems.2.3 Noise Reduction and Smooth OperationThe integration of gears in geared DC motors aids in reducing noise levels and improving operational smoothness. The gear system eliminates irregular movements, resulting in improved rotation stability, reduced vibrations, and smoother mechanical transitions. This characteristic is highly advantageous in industries where noise reduction and precision are vital, such as medical equipment, research instruments, and aerospace applications.Section 3: Applications of Geared DC Motors3.1 Robotics and AutomationGeared DC motors play a pivotal role in the development of robotics and automation technologies. By harnessing the power of these motors, [Company Name] has reshaped the manufacturing landscape, helping businesses enhance productivity and competitiveness.The key to the success of DC Step Motors lies in their unique design and functionality. These motors operate by dividing a complete rotation into a series of smaller steps. By precisely controlling these steps, manufacturers can achieve accurate and repeatable motion that is vital for many production processes. This level of precision ensures that components are positioned correctly, minimizing errors and providing consistent quality.One of the significant advantages of DC Step Motors is their ability to operate in an open-loop system, eliminating the need for costly and complex feedback devices. This simplicity reduces overall system costs while improving reliability. Additionally, these motors offer exceptional torque-to-size ratios, making them ideal for applications with limited space or weight constraints.The versatility of DC Step Motors is another aspect that sets them apart.
